Foundation waterproofing services involve applying specialized barriers and coatings to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. These treatments are designed to prevent water infiltration by sealing cracks, joints, and porous materials that can allow moisture to penetrate. The process may include installing drainage systems, applying waterproof membranes, or sealing foundation walls to create a barrier against groundwater and surface water. Proper foundation waterproofing helps maintain the structural integrity of a building by reducing the risk of water damage that can compromise walls, floors, and overall stability.

Foundation Waterproofing Costs - The typical cost range for foundation waterproofing services varies from approximately $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a standard residential basement may cost around $3,500, while larger or more extensive work could reach $7,500 or more.
Material and Method Expenses - Expenses for waterproofing materials and methods generally fall between $1,500 and $6,000. Basic sealant applications might cost around $1,500, whereas installing membrane systems or interior drainage solutions can push costs toward $6,000 or higher.
Labor and Inspection Fees - Labor costs for foundation waterproofing typically range from $1,000 to $4,000, influenced by project size and accessibility. Additional inspection or consultation fees may add a few hundred dollars to the overall expense.
Additional Factors Influencing Cost - Costs can vary based on foundation condition, the extent of excavation required, and local contractor rates. For properties in Chicago, IL, typical projects might fall within these ranges, but prices can differ based on spec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Foundation waterproofing services are often sought by property owners in Chicago, IL to address issues caused by heavy rainfall, snowmelt, or high groundwater levels that can lead to basement leaks or dampness. These services help protect homes from water intrusion, which can cause structural damage and mold growth if left unaddressed. Property owners may consider waterproofing when they notice signs of moisture, such as peeling paint, musty odors, or visible water stains on basement walls or floors.
